Event between (517717) 15KZ120 and star GA1220:04075395 with event index number of 267223
Geocentric closest approach at 2018/10/20 08:59:58 UTC
J2000 position of star is 17:02:09.2 +32:21:38
Equinox of date position of star is 17:02:51.5 +32:20:05
Stellar brightness G=15.1,
use SENSEUP=128
Star is 91 degrees from the moon.
Moon is 82% illuminated.
TNO apparent brightness V=19.8
TNO is 8.4 AU from the Sun
and 8.8 AU from the Earth.
The TNO is moving 22.9
km/sec on the sky relative to the star, or,
12.9 arcsec/hr.
The 1-sigma error in the time of the event is 16 seconds.
The 1-sigma cross-track error in the shadow position is
636 km.
The TNO has an absolute magnitude Hv=10.0
Diameter=60.3 km assuming a 5% albedo -- 2.6 sec chord
Diameter=24.6 km assuming a 30% albedo -- 1.1 sec chord
Dynamical classification is CENTAURR
